West Central Illinois Services

 

Child & Family Connections #17

Services Available: Assists families with evaluations and assessments of child, age birth to three years, to determine eligibility for Early Intervention services.

Geographic Area: Adams, Brown, Calhoun, Cass, Greene, Jersey, Morgan, Pike, and Scott counties.

Population Served: Birth to three children with suspected delays such as: difficulty with movement, speaking clearly, understanding language, behavior difficulties. Children having a condition such as vision or hearing loss, cerebral palsy, down syndrome, seizures, low birth weight, spina bifida, etc.

Eligibility Criteria: Eligibility is based on a 30% or greater delay in development or an established medical condition with a known probability for developmental delay.

Fees/Costs: Free screening and assessments. Cost of services by licensed professionals is determined case by case.

Hours: 8 a.m. to 4 p.m. Monday through Friday Or leave a message on voice mail.

Other: Early intervention services include one or more of the following: Service coordination, parent liaison, developmental therapy, physical therapy, occupational therapy, nutrition, audiology, assistive technology, psychological, social work, vision, medical, nursing health, and transportation.
